xxxxxxxxxx
function setup() {
createCanvas(1366, 549);
background('black');
setupBg();
setupEarth();
setupScore();
setupUpgrades();
}
function draw() {
clear();
background('black');
if(earth.mouse.presses('left')) {
score = score + (multi);
scoreBox.text = ("Planet points: ⇟" + score);
}
if(kb.presses('space')) {
score = score + (multi);
scoreBox.text = ("Planet points: ⇟" + score);
}
if(kb.pressing('space')) {
earth.img.scale = 1.2;
effects.diameter = 157;
} else {earth.img.scale = 1; effects.diameter = 130;};
if(earth.mouse.pressing('left')) {
earth.img.scale = 1.2;
effects.diameter = 157;
} else {earth.img.scale = 1; effects.diameter = 130;};
if(u1Bought == false) {
if(u1.mouse.presses('left')) {
if(score > 149) {
u1.text = ("Upgraded!");
multi = 10000;
u1.textSize = 20;
score = score - 150;
u1.life = 180;
let u1Bought = true;
}
}
}
if(u2Bought == false) {
if(u2.mouse.presses('left')) {
if(score > 399) {
u2.text = ("Upgraded!");
multi = 100000;
u2.textSize = 20;
score = score - 400;
effects.stroke = '#006DFF59';
effects.color = '#006DFF59';
u2.life = 180;
let u2Bought = true;
}
}
}
if(u3Bought == false) {
if(u3.mouse.presses('left')) {
if(score > 999) {
u3.text = ("Upgraded!");
multi = 10;
u3.textSize = 20;
score = score - 1000000000;
u3.life = 180;
let u3Bought = true;
satMainSet();
}
}
}
if(u1Bought == true) {
u1.life = u1.life - 1;
if(u1.life < 1) {
u1.remove();
}
}
if(u2Bought == true) {
u2.life = u2.life - 1;
if(u2.life < 1) {
u2.remove();
}
}
if(u3Bought == true) {
u3.life = u3.life - 1;
if(u3.life < 1) {
u3.remove();
}
}
scoreBox.text = ("Planet points: ⇟" + score);
}